Shares of Snap Inc (NYSE: SNAP) gained about 10% today after Amazon.com Inc (NASDAQ: AMZN) confirmed that it has partnered with the social media giant.
Amazon to collaborate with Snapchat
The eCommerce behemoth will now enable Snapchat users in the U.S. to buy certain items without having to leave the social media app. According to Amazon:
Customers in the U.S. will see real-time pricing, prime eligibility, delivery estimates, and product details on select Amazon product ads in Snapchat as part of the new experience.
Note that AMZN already has similar agreements with the likes of Pinterest and Meta Platforms as well. The deal it announced today will likely help Snap Inc accelerate recovery in its ads business.
Snap stock has gained a whopping 45% in less than two months.
Social shopping has been on the rise
The said collaboration is equally exciting for Amazon as well considering Snapchat now has a user base that sits north of 400 million in total as Invezz reported here .

Snap, however, seems to be taking a different direction to capitalise on the rising trend of social shopping than TikTok that’s committed to introducing its own online store.
In September, the yellow camera app decided to pull the plug on its augment reality for enterprise services or ARES business. Wall Street currently has a consensus “hold” rating on Snap stock.
